The postcode NG12 2FU is located in Rushcliffe, in the county of Nottinghamshire.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. NG12 2FU is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

NG12 2FU is one of the least de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 8 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of NG12 2FU as Suburbanites > Semi-detached suburbia > White suburban communities.

The closest road name to NG12 2FU is Eastwood Road which is centered 107 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Eastwood Road and is 62 m away. The closest railway station is Radcliffe (Notts) Rail Station, 257 m away.

The closest primary school to NG12 2FU (for ages 11 and under) is Radcliffe-on-Trent Junior School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on February 14, 2018.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is South Nottinghamshire Academy. The last OFSTED inspection on February 22, 2017 rated this school as Good

The local pub for residents of NG12 2FU is Yard Of Ale and is 233 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on December 4, 2020. The nearest takeaway food is available from Snack Stop and is 0 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on January 6, 2022.

Residents reported an average download speed of 104.6 Mbps and an average upload speed of 12.5 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.8 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for NG12 2FU is covered by the Nottinghamshire police force association and Nottinghamshire County Teaching is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
